Study habits
In this lesson, we're going to talk about study habits and best practices, so let's dive right in. Wake up before everybody else. Quiet time is incredibly important. If you have that time to be in a quiet space, use it. Things sink in better. The distractions, the noise, they don't help sometimes. As crazy as it sounds, I'll go to like Starbucks or something, a coffee shop and I'll have my noise canceling headphones on and I'll study my brains out because I need people to be around, which is kind of weird. I'm not listening to them, I'm not paying any attention to them. The movement, it's like you're lost in a room full of people and in your own world. And when you can get to that tuned out kind of thing, that's when you really focus. It's super cool. Try it. You may like it. Stay up after everybody else goes to bed, right? It's difficult.
